Instabilelab, the Venetian brand that reinterprets the concept of wallpaper and every surface of the indoor living room, presents MILANO COLLECTION. Dedicated to the company's first participation in the Salone del Mobile, the new collection evokes the canons of haute couture with ten graphics with the unmistakable creative stamp of Instabilelab, introducing a wallpaper, VELVET, and the tufted carpets CARPETIA ROYAL.

Continuing its path of constant study of textures, materials and new methods of application, Instabilelab renews its proposal with a unique style, following a design thought that wants to redefine the traditional canons of surfaces such as wallpapers and carpets.

“The name Milano Collection was chosen both to highlight the first participation of Instabilelab - says Stefano Munaretto, founder and Art Director of Instabilelab - and to give this collection a connotation of style and prestige, qualities that cannot fail to refer to Milan, the capital of fashion and design. The ten graphics in the catalog have been specially designed to highlight the two new materials we bring to the fair: Velvet and Carpetia Royal. "

VELVET. An unprecedented wallpaper even more precious

A very refined wallpaper that recalls the textures and the soft tactile perceptions of velvet. The new Instabilelab proposal is a new precious support that stands out from the usual wallpapers, to enhance walls and environments giving an elegant and surprising appearance.

CARPETIA ROYAL. A fine carpet for classy environments

Very soft, shiny and effective are the new carpets that Instabilelab offers for a target that seeks quality and aesthetic performance at the highest levels. Presented in two shapes (rectangular and round) and in different sizes, these furnishing accessories define the space as distinctive elements with a strong expressive power.
